The digital landscape of modern education has shifted significantly, moving away from rote memorization toward interactive, social, and student-centered learning. At the heart of this transformation is the concept of a "classroom community"—an environment where students feel safe, valued, and connected to one another. Websites and platforms like ClassroomCommunity.com have become instrumental in this shift, specifically through the integration of educational games. These games are not merely distractions; they are sophisticated pedagogical tools designed to foster collaboration, reinforce academic concepts, and build a cohesive social fabric within the learning environment.
